[LatinaLUG] Programmino Problematico
Polli Roberto
latina@lists.linux.it
Thu, 15 May 2003 18:35:00 +0200
Ciao a tutti!
Eccovi un bel problemino.
Devo scrivere un programma apparentemente semplice.
Tale programma
1) partira' subito dopo il login di un utente
2) se il DISPLAY e' settato lancera' un'interfaccia grafica altrimenti
partira' in modalita' testo
3) a seconda della scelta dell'utente settera' una variabile d'ambiente
fin qui sembrerebbe tutto facilissimo (questa soluzione l'ho gia
implementata in tcl/tk).
Il problema e' che tale sw deve avere anche I seguenti requisiti
4) l'utente non deve poter interrompere tale programma, esso dev'essere
un passaggio obbligato;l'interruzione non deve essere possibile neanche
mediante la chiusura della finestra che lo contiene (per la versione
grafica)
5) tale programma deve girare su diverse piattaforme unix
(sun,sgi,ibm,...)
Esiste una soluzione semplice a tale quesito, che possibilmente non faccia
ricorso alla programmazione motif+c?
Se proprio tale programmazione fosse obbligata, I sorgenti cambierebbero tra
le diverse piattaforme o sarebbero gli stessi?
Grazie di tutto,
Peace, Rob